What Is Ripstop Fabric?
Ripstop fabric is a woven textile that incorporates stronger reinforcement yarns at regular intervals throughout the fabric.
These reinforcement yarns create a visible grid pattern.
The purpose of this structure is simple:
If the fabric is punctured or damaged, the reinforced grid helps prevent the tear from spreading.
This significantly improves durability while keeping the fabric lightweight.
Ripstop construction can be applied to various materials, including:
- Nylon
- Polyester
- Cotton blends
- Technical synthetic fabrics
Why Is It Called Ripstop?
The name comes directly from its function.
"Rip" refers to a tear in the fabric.
"Stop" refers to the fabric's ability to limit tear expansion.
While ripstop fabrics are not completely tear-proof, they are much more resistant to damage than conventional woven fabrics of similar weight.
This makes them particularly useful in demanding outdoor environments.
How Ripstop Fabric Works
The key feature of ripstop fabric is its reinforced grid.
During weaving, stronger yarns are inserted at regular intervals, creating a network of reinforcement points.
If a small tear develops, the stronger yarns help contain the damage before it spreads further.
Think of it as a built-in safety net within the fabric structure.
This design allows manufacturers to use lighter fabrics without sacrificing durability.
Common Types of Ripstop Fabric
Ripstop Nylon
Ripstop nylon is one of the most popular options in outdoor apparel.
Advantages:
✔ Lightweight
✔ Strong tensile strength
✔ Excellent abrasion resistance
✔ Quick drying
Common Uses:
- Windbreakers
- Hiking jackets
- Tents
- Backpacks
Ripstop Polyester
Ripstop polyester offers many similar benefits.
Advantages:
✔ Better UV resistance
✔ Lower moisture absorption
✔ Good color retention
✔ Cost-effective
Common Uses:
- Outdoor apparel
- Workwear
- Rain jackets
- Travel clothing
Stretch Ripstop Fabrics
Modern outdoor apparel often combines ripstop construction with stretch technology.
Advantages:
✔ Improved mobility
✔ Better comfort
✔ Enhanced durability
Common Uses:
- Hiking pants
- Softshell garments
- Climbing apparel

Common Myths About Ripstop Fabric
Myth 1: Ripstop Fabric Is Tear-Proof
False.
Ripstop fabrics can still be damaged.
However, they are much better at preventing small tears from becoming larger problems.
Myth 2: Ripstop Fabric Is Heavy
False.
Many ripstop fabrics are actually lighter than traditional alternatives.
Myth 3: All Ripstop Fabrics Are the Same
False.
Performance varies based on:
- Fiber type
- Yarn size
- Fabric weight
- Coatings and finishes
Myth 4: Ripstop Is Only for Military Gear
False.
Today, ripstop fabrics are widely used in outdoor apparel, travel products, sportswear, and workwear.
